To see if a pair of ratios is proportional... you need to compute for its cross products. If the cross products are equal then they are proportional.
a/b = c/d where ad = bc
a) 4/9 = 16/45 ⇒ 4*45 = 9*16 ⇒ 180 = 144 NOT PROPORTIONAL
b) 5/12 = 25/144 ⇒ 5*144 = 12*25 ⇒ 720 = 300 NOT PROPORTIONAL
c) 12/18 = 18/27 ⇒ 12*27 = 18*18 ⇒ 324 = 324 PROPORTIONAL
d)15/20 = 7/10 ⇒ 15*10 = 20*7 ⇒ 150 = 140 NOT PROPORTIONAL
